The Under-17 football team of the Afigya Kwabre South District has delivered an impressive performance at the ongoing Ashantifest, securing a memorable victory over the team from Asokore Mampong Municipal Assembly in the quarterfinal stage of the Ashantifest Inter-District Under-17 Football Competition.
The thrilling encounter, played at the Afigya Kwabre District Stadium, saw the young footballers from Afigya Kwabre South display exceptional skill, discipline and teamwork as they battled their opponents in a highly competitive match that drew cheers from spectators and football enthusiasts.
The victory has not only secured the district a place in the semifinals but has also ignited excitement among residents, who are proud to see their young talents representing the district with determination and passion.
Speaking after the match, the District Chief Executive for Afigya Kwabre South, Patricia Pearl Ankrah, praised the team for their dedication and spirited performance, describing the win as a clear indication of the district’s rich reservoir of football talent.
According to her, the impressive showing by the team demonstrates that the district possesses enormous potential in sports development, particularly among the youth.
She also extended her appreciation to the Ashanti Regional Minister, Dr. Frank Amoakohene, for initiating the Ashantifest football competition, noting that the programme provides a unique platform for young footballers across the region to showcase their talents and pursue their sporting dreams.

The Ashantifest, under which the football competition is being held, is a flagship regional celebration aimed at promoting cultural heritage, tourism, unity and socio-economic development within the Ashanti Region.
Beyond football, the festival features a wide range of cultural displays, exhibitions, and community development activities designed to highlight the rich traditions and vibrancy of the region.
Sports, particularly football, have become one of the major attractions of the festival, drawing large crowds and providing an avenue for youth engagement across the region.
